  4. Andy,

    listen to Jim. 

    250 SSD for your OS. Keep it “lean”. 

    1gb M.2 for samples. 

    Edit: 1 tb, I’m on my phone, pita!

    Conventional 7200 hd for projects.

    at least one more hd for data, backups etc.

    I’m not a composer who does “huge” orchestral mockups. 

    But I can tell you that the M.2 loads Superior Drummer Trilian Kontact “right now”. 

    Best money I spent last year!
